There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Dustin is 28.7% cheaper than Ingalls. With a cost index of 57 vs 79,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Dustin to Ingalls should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

When it comes to buying, median home values in Dustin are $55,000 compared to $97,500 in Ingalls, a 44% gap.

Median household income in Dustin is $23,250 compared to $84,792 in Ingalls (-72.6%). While Ingalls is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
